Wayne Gretzky was introduced as an honorary captain of Team Canada on Thursday night prior to the Matchup against the US in the 4 Nations Face-off final.

Gretzky, arguably the biggest hockey player of all time, received some cheer when he stepped out on the ice with Team US choice, Mike Eruzione. Obviously, the Boston amount was far more behind Eruzione than they were “the big one.”

On social media, Gretzky’s performance as Team Canada’s honorary captain withdrew some Ire because of President Donald Trump’s Musings about the United States’ northern neighbors, who became the 51st state in the Union. The president has even gone so far as to suggest that Gretzky is “Governor” of Canada.

Hockey fans who looked at the game were far from entertained.

Gretzky was discovered at Trump’s inauguration last month. Trump proclaimed Hockey legend on Christmas Day and suggested that Canadians were drafting him to become the next prime minister.

When Trump teased Canadian lawmakers, he said he asked Gretzky to become “Governor of Canada.”

“I was with Wayne Gretzky. I said, ‘Wayne, would you like to be Governor of Canada?’ I can’t imagine anyone doing better than Wayne, “Trump said at a press conference in Mar-A-Lago earlier this month.

“Wayne wasn’t too interested. But he would probably have wished for state,” Trump added. “He’s one of my friends. He’s an amazing guy. He’s the big one. We call him the big one? He’s not? He’s an amazing hockey player.”

Gretzky did not appear to be swayed one way or the other.
